Controversial midfielder to spend season in Ligue 1

Sky Sports understands QPR midfielder Joey Barton is set to join Ligue 1 side Marseille on a season-long loan deal, with Stephane Mbia moving in the opposite direction. Doubt over whether Barton has a future at Loftus Road was fuelled earlier on Thursday when his old number 17 shirt was given to summer signing Ryan Nelsen. The midfielder must serve a 12-game ban to start the season after his red card and violent conduct in the final match of the last campaign against former club Manchester City. It now appears the 29-year-old, who was also stripped of QPR's captaincy over the summer and previously trained with League Two Fleetwood Town, will spend the season in France. It will mark the first time the once-capped England international, formerly of City and Newcastle, has plied his trade at an overseas club. Barton perhaps teasingly wished his Twitter followers "Bonne nuit" - French for "good night" - on Thursday evening. Mbia, who can play at centre-back and in midfield, is poised to move the other way on a season-long loan in West London. The 26-year-old Cameroon international joined Marseille from Rennes in 2009 and made 15 Ligue 1 appearances last season.
